Can the middle east use its natural resources to improve the lives of its people

The Middle East has always had a rich abundance of natural resources, although which resources are coveted and valued has changed over time. Today, abundant petroleum fields dominate the area's economy. The Middle East is similarly disproportionately rich in natural gas (32 percent of the world's known natural gas reserves are in the region) and phosphate (Morocco alone has more than half of the world's reserves).

Water has always been an important resource in the Middle East -- for its relative scarcity rather than its abundance. Disputes over rights to water (for example, building a dam in one country upstream from another) are a fundamental part of the political relationships in the region. Water for irrigation is necessary for many of the ecosystems to sustain crops.
